Scripture: Proverbs 21:1–5
Devotion
Money can move our hearts faster than we realize. Proverbs reminds us, “The plans of the diligent certainly lead to profit, but anyone who is reckless certainly becomes poor” (v.5). At its core, this passage is about our hearts. Financial wisdom isn’t about gaining or maintaining wealth, it’s about stewardship. Everything we possess and influence comes from God. We are simply stewards. Financial wisdom calls us to slow down long enough to pray, plan, and prioritize.
I remember learning early in marriage that “impulse buys” and “intentional stewardship” rarely go hand in hand. Money, if not managed properly, can create conflict and corruption. When money makes us selfish, it leads to brokenness and poverty in our relationships and with God. But when we live openhanded and generously, like Jesus who gave Himself away, we experience true wealth in a deeper sense. Proverbs understands this and invites us to work diligently, save wisely, and give generously. When we live this way, it reflects a heart that trusts God more than our bank account.
This passage teaches us that we can rest because our Provider never runs dry. Financial wisdom is less about math and more about mindset. Every dollar can be a tool for kingdom momentum. Whether you’re budgeting or helping someone in need, seek diligence and faithfulness over idleness and flash. God honors those who handle His resources well.
